Mid and South Essex NHS Foundation Trust is the only acute hospital provider in the Mid and South Essex Integrated Care System (ICS), which is a system of health and care partners working together for our local population.

Within Mid and South Essex there are 149 GP practices, operating from over 200 sites, forming 27 Primary Care Networks and one Ambulance Trust. There are also three main community and mental health service providers who work together through a community collaborative.

We collaborate with other valuable partners, including three Healthwatch organisations, nine voluntary and community sector organisations and three top tier local authorities, with seven district, borough and city councils, as well as our local universities.

 

Job overview

This is an exciting opportunity to work within the Main Outpatient at Orsett/Basildon Hospital.

The Registered Nurse will function as part of the multi-disciplinary team within the Outpatient Department to provide a seamless service & high-quality care to patients, working collaboratively as part of the outpatient team.

Main duties of the job

If you join our team, you will: 

  • Provide a high standard of care to patients, whilst maintaining at all times their privacy and dignity 
  • Assess care needs, develop, implement and evaluate programmes of care
  • Contribute to supporting the Senior Sister/Charge Nurse
  • Support the maintenance of high standards of cleanliness in their own clinical area 
  • Actively promote and maintain self-development.
